Scheduled Maintenance Service For Emission Control And Proper Vehicle Performance

Inspection and service should be performed any time if a malfunction is observed or suspected.

SCHEDULED MAINTENANCE CHART

NO. EMISSION CONTROL SYSTEM MAINTENANCE SERVICE INTERVALS KILOMETERS IN THOUSANDS 24 48 72 96 120 144 168 192
MILEAGE IN THOUSANDS 15 30 45 60 75 90 105 120
MONTHS 12 24 36 48 60 72 84 96
1 Fuel system (tank, pipe line and connection, and fuel tank filler tube cap) Check for leaks       X       X
2 Fuel hoses Check condition   X(1)   X   X   X
3 Air cleaner filter Replace   X   X   X   X
4 Evaporative emission control system (except evaporative emission canister) Check for leaks and clogging       X       X
5 Spark plugs Standard type Replace   X   X   X   X
Platinum-tipped type       X       X
Iridium-tipped type Every 84 monthsor every 168,000 km (105,000 miles)
6 Intake and exhaust valve clearance (4G6-MIVEC engine only) Inspect andadjust
If valve noise increases, adjust valve clearance
  X   X   X   X
7 Timing belt Replace Every 96,000 km (60,000 miles) (2)
NOTE: Replace the timing belt at every 168,000 km (105,000 miles) when it has not been replaced at the first 96,000 km (60,000 miles).
8 Drive belts (for the generator, water pump and power steering pump) Check condition   X   X   X   X
9 Exhaust system (connection portion of muffler, muffler pipes and converter heat shields) Check and service   X(1)   X   X   X
(1) This maintenance is recommended but is not required to maintain the emissions warranty.
(2) For California, Massachusetts, Vermont and Maine, this maintenance is recommended but is not required to maintain the emissions warranty.
